Worldwide Randomized Antibiotic EnveloPe Infection PrevenTion Trial (WRAP-IT)

Background:
- Cardiac implantable electronic device (CIED) infections pose significant risks, leading to increased morbidity and mortality.
- Preventing CIED infections is crucial for improving patient outcomes and reducing healthcare burdens.
Purpose of the Study:
- To evaluate the efficacy of the Medtronic TYRX absorbable envelope in preventing CIED infections.
- To assess the cost-effectiveness of using the TYRX absorbable envelope.
- To gain insights into the pathophysiology and risk factors associated with CIED infections.
Main Methods:
- The WRAP-IT study is a large, randomized, prospective, multi-center, international, single-blinded trial.
- Enrollment of up to 7,764 subjects undergoing CIED procedures (replacement, upgrade, revision, or de novo CRT-D implant).
- Participants are randomized 1:1 to receive the TYRX envelope or standard care; primary endpoint is major CIED infection at 12 months.
Main Results:
- Primary endpoint: Major CIED infection rates at 12 months post-procedure.
- Secondary analysis: Performance of Medtronic's lead monitoring algorithms in specific CIED systems.
Conclusions:
- The WRAP-IT trial will provide robust data on the TYRX absorbable envelope's effectiveness in reducing CIED infections.
- Findings will inform clinical practice regarding infection prevention strategies for CIEDs.
- The study aims to enhance understanding of CIED infection mechanisms and identify key risk factors.
